Three Advanced Abs Exercises

Given below are three advanced abs exercises for those looking for advances abs exercises:
1. ‘Knees tucks' is a challenging and advanced abs exercise. This will help you will help you achieve target balancing, sore strength and stability. For this exercise you have to position yourself similar to push ups with the only difference that your ankles/shin is placed over a ball. Ensure that your body is straight with back flat and the abs engaged. Now you have to roll the ball by bending your knees towards chest and squeeze the abs at the same time. Do not use your arms and make sure that ball movement is done with the knees. Also, you should not collapse your back when rolling. Return to initial position and perform ten to sixteen repetitions.
2. ‘Ball pikes' is another challenging abs exercise and is an advanced version of knee tucks. For this exercise you have to get into a position similar to pushups with the only difference that a ball is placed under ankles/shins. To make exercise more challenging place your feet over the ball. Make sure that your body is straight with your back flat and abs engaged. Now roll the ball towards your chest using feet or ankles and squeeze the abs, at the same time lift your hips towards the ceiling. If you want the exercise to be more challenging you should make sure that your legs are straight such that your toes are on the ball. Return to initial position and perform ten to sixteen repetitions.
3. ‘Oblique knee drops' is a great exercise for targeting the obliques, rectus abdominis and back. Lie on your back such that your knees are bent at a right angle. Place a medicine ball in between your knees and form an airplane using your arms stretched at your side with palms facing towards ceiling. Now, contracting your abs lower your knees down to the right. Try to lower it as much you can without providing strain on your back or lifting your shoulders. After this squeeze your abs and feel the obliques to contract. Then draw up your knees back and do to the same for the left side. Perform one to three sets with a repetition of ten to sixteen for alternative sides.
